About
Édouard Ngirente is a Rwandan economist and politician. Born in 1973, he served as the Prime Minister of Rwanda from August 2017 to July 2025. Appointed by President Paul Kagame, Ngirente played a key role in shaping Rwanda's economic policies during his tenure. His background in economics provided a foundation for his leadership in the country's development efforts. Ngirente's service as Prime Minister marks a significant chapter in Rwandan politics and governance.
